JavaTM 2 Platform
Standard Edition

Uses of Interface
java.rmi.server.RemoteCall

Packages that use RemoteCall
java.rmi.server Provides classes and interfaces for supporting the server side of RMI. 
 

Uses of RemoteCall in java.rmi.server
 

Methods in java.rmi.server that return RemoteCall
 RemoteCall RemoteRef.newCall(RemoteObject obj, Operation[] op, int opnum, long hash)
          Deprecated. JDK1.2 style stubs no longer use this method. Instead of using a sequence of method calls on the stub's the remote reference (newCall, invoke, and done), a stub uses a single method, invoke(Remote, Method, Object[], int), on the remote reference to carry out parameter marshalling, remote method executing and unmarshalling of the return value.

JDK1.2 stubs are generated using rmic -v1.2. By default, rmic generates stubs compatible with JDK1.1 and JDK1.2. The compatible stubs can also be generated using rmic -vcompat.

 

Methods in java.rmi.server with parameters of type RemoteCall
 void RemoteRef.invoke(RemoteCall call)
          Deprecated. JDK1.2 style stubs no longer use this method. Instead of using a sequence of method calls to the remote reference (newCall, invoke, and done), a stub uses a single method, invoke(Remote, Method, Object[], int), on the remote reference to carry out parameter marshalling, remote method executing and unmarshalling of the return value.

JDK1.2 stubs are generated using rmic -v1.2. By default, rmic generates stubs compatible with JDK1.1 and JDK1.2. The compatible stubs can also be generated using rmic -vcompat.

 void RemoteRef.done(RemoteCall call)
          Deprecated. JDK1.2 style stubs no longer use this method. Instead of using a sequence of method calls to the remote reference (newCall, invoke, and done), a stub uses a single method, invoke(Remote, Method, Object[], int), on the remote reference to carry out parameter marshalling, remote method executing and unmarshalling of the return value.

JDK1.2 stubs are generated using rmic -v1.2. By default, rmic generates stubs compatible with JDK1.1 and JDK1.2. The compatible stubs can also be generated using rmic -vcompat.

 void Skeleton.dispatch(Remote obj, RemoteCall theCall, int opnum, long hash)
          Deprecated. no replacement
 


JavaTM 2 Platform
Standard Edition

Submit a bug or feature
Java, Java 2D, and JDBC are a trademarks or registered trademarks of Sun Microsystems, Inc. in the US and other countries.
Copyright 1993-1999 Sun Microsystems, Inc. 901 San Antonio Road,
Palo Alto, California, 94303, U.S.A. All Rights Reserved.